An examination of the maximum resolution at which terrain can be displayed in FS2002 and FS2004. IMPORTANT! Since this article was written, FS2004 Update has restored FS2004 to 19m capability.

Does all this matter? (2)

If you compare this to the previous screenshot, you'll see the greater terrain display resolution coming into play in tightening up the definition of the V-shaped valley in and ridges, particularly in the foreground.

The differences here are not enough to spoil your party if you're restricted to FS2004's ~38m, though they do have more noticable effects in areas of more extreme terrain such as cliffs where the extra resolution in FS2002 contributes to helping prevent grass textures fall over the edge of cliffs or sea textures climbing up the base of cliffs.
